Tuesday was named for the Roman god of war, Mars, so in Latin was known as dies Martis. front control interface moduleWebApr 17, 2024 · In Italian, there are the following days of the week: Lunedi (Monday) – Luna’s day (Moon’s day) Martedi (Tuesday) – God Mars’ day. Mercoledi (Wednesday) – God Mercury’s day. Giovedi (Thursday) – God Jupiter’s day. Venerdi (Friday) – Goddess Venus’ day.
